Pro Tips

– For extra crispy crust, broil the salmon for the last 2-3 minutes of cooking.

– Experiment with different herbs like dill or chives for a unique flavor profile.

– Serve the Parmesan-crusted salmon with a squeeze of fresh lemon juice for a burst of citrusy goodness.

Ingredients

  • 4 fresh salmon fillets
  • 1 cup grated Parmesan cheese
  • 1/2 cup breadcrumbs
  • 2 tablespoons fresh parsley, chopped
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ced
  • 2 tablespoons olive oil
  • Salt and pepper to taste

Directions

  1. Preheat the oven to 400°F (200°C) and line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
  2. In a bowl, combine grated Parmesan, breadcrumbs, minced garlic, chopped parsley, olive oil, salt, and pepper.
  3. Pat the salmon fillets dry with a paper towel and place them on the prepared baking sheet.
  4. Generously coat the top of each fillet with the Parmesan mixture, pressing it gently to adhere.
  5. Bake the salmon for 12-15 minutes or until the crust is golden brown and the fish flakes easily with a fork.
  6. Remove from the oven and let it rest for a few minutes before serving.
